The shipbuilding sector often favors laser cutting for its precise cuts, clean edges, and minimal heat-affected zone. This particularly applies when working with marine-grade steel plate materials and complex shapes.

| Cutting Principle | Use a focused, high-intensity laser beam to cut material |
| Precision | High precision and accuracy |
| Edge Quality | Smooth, clean edge, often with minimal post-processing |
| Cutting Speed | Faster for thin to medium-thick material |
| Material Thickness | Excels at cutting thin to medium-thick materials |
| Heat-Affected Zone(HAZ) | Minimal heat-affected zone, reducting distortion |
| Material Compatibility | Can process a wide range of materials, including non-metals |
| Operating Cost | The higher initial investment, lower consumable cost |
| Kerf Width | Narrow kerf, redcuing material waste |
| Noise and Debris | Quietet operation and less debris production |
